Where to stay in Gargunnock

Gargunnock, a charming rural village in central Scotland, offers a delightful escape for travellers seeking culture and stunning scenery. Explore the friendly atmosphere as you venture into nearby Kinbuck, where history and natural beauty intertwine. Experience the warmth of the local community while discovering the hidden gems of undiscovered Scotland. With its picturesque landscapes and rich heritage, Gargunnock is the perfect base for an unforgettable Scottish adventure.

  • Stirling: Stirling, a historic city rich in Scottish heritage, is conveniently located near Gargunnock. With its stunning landscapes, outdoor adventures, and vibrant shopping areas, Stirling is a must-visit. The city is famous for its iconic attractions such as the Wallace Monument and Stirling Castle, which offer breathtaking views and a glimpse into the nation's past. The surrounding national park provides ample opportunities for hiking and exploring nature, making it a popular choice for travellers seeking outdoor experiences. With visitor numbers peaking in April, July, and September, it's a lively hub for both culture and adventure.
  • Kippen: Just 4.8km from Gargunnock, the charming village of Kippen invites you to experience its picturesque scenery and outdoor activities. Known for its tranquil setting and friendly atmosphere, Kippen is ideal for those looking to explore the beauty of the Scottish countryside. The village is close to national parks and local parks, perfect for leisurely walks or picnics. With peak visitor numbers in June to July and September, Kippen provides a serene retreat while still being near more bustling areas.
  • Blair Drummond: Located 6.4km from Gargunnock, Blair Drummond is a delightful village popular with families. Known for its outdoor attractions, including the Blair Drummond Safari Park, this area offers a unique blend of adventure and wildlife experiences. The local amenities, including theatres and amusement parks, cater to all ages, ensuring a fun-filled visit. With seasonal peaks in visitor numbers, particularly in April and June to July, Blair Drummond is an excellent destination for those seeking family-friendly outings amidst stunning natural beauty.

Find the best attractions near Gargunnock

Gargunnock, nestled in Stirling, Scotland, is a fantastic destination for those seeking a blend of culture and outdoor adventures. Visitors can explore captivating castles, historic monuments, and intriguing ruins, making it ideal for romantic getaways or cultural experiences. With its stunning scenery and rich heritage, Gargunnock promises a memorable vacation for all types of travellers.

  • Stirling Castle: Located 8.0km from Gargunnock, Stirling Castle offers a rich tapestry of Scottish history and stunning architecture. With its dramatic settings, it exudes a romantic atmosphere, making it an ideal spot to explore royal history and enjoy panoramic views of the surrounding landscape.
  • Falkirk Wheel: Situated 20.9km from Gargunnock, the Falkirk Wheel is an ingenious rotating boat lift that showcases modern engineering alongside cultural significance. Visitors can appreciate its unique design while enjoying the picturesque scenery of the surrounding area.
  • Loch Ard Forest: About 24.1km from Gargunnock, Loch Ard Forest invites adventurers to immerse themselves in nature. With a network of trails and beautiful landscapes, it offers an outdoor experience filled with opportunities for walking, cycling, and wildlife spotting.

Best time to go to Gargunnock

The best time to visit Gargunnock can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ature in Gargunnock falls in July, when visitor numbers are slightly low and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ain. The coolest average temperature in Gargunnock falls in January, vis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

What's the seasonal weather in Gargunnock?
The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 13°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 3°C. Average annual precipitation for Gargunnock is 1137 mm.
